About the role – 8 month Contract

The Risk & Compliance Lead’s main priorities are to build risk awareness, understanding and maturity through EnergyAustralia’s Technology teams. This role provides comprehensive first line of defence &oversight of Technology risk identification, recording/tracking, control testing, and remediation, and works closely with the Enterprise Risk team to ensure consistency of approach and reporting across the organisation. Additional responsibilities include:

  • Audit coordination; engaging with both internal and external auditors and Group Security
  • Compliance management including general compliance administration duties
  • Analyse risk likelihood and consequence ratings and ensure they are appropriate and updated as remediation/mitigation activities are completed
  • Maintain a central register of controls (key and non-key) that technology manages in support of our risk management and regulatory obligations
  • Work with project management on a periodic basis to ensure Portfolio planning activities are prioritised around key risks within technology.

 

What we’re looking for:

You will have strong risk and compliance experience in similar complex organisations to EnergyAustralia. Additionally, you will have some of the following expertise:

  • Experience in risk, compliance, and governance related roles ideally with Utility (electricity, gas, water) industry exposure
  • Knowledge of risk and risk control assessment and frameworks including ISO31000, ITIL and ISO27001
  • Broad knowledge of IT generally, networking technologies, application technologies and cloud services
  • Thrives in a dynamic, task orientated and fast-paced environment whilst meeting set deadlines/schedules
  • Exceptional attention to detail, written and verbal communication skills and trouble-shooting skills
  • Commitment to your team colleagues by displaying a highly collaborative and supportive style
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with experience in data analysis and interpretation
